The school aims to create a broad, balanced and relevant education for all pupils, in a safe and caring atmosphere. Burry Port is a small seaside town, some five miles to the west of Llanelli. The area is one which is developing economically, with recent developments in the field of tourism and leisure. ICT is regarded as a valuable tool that promotes a learning partnership which includes pupils, staff, governors, parents, carers and the whole community.
Every pupil and member of staff in the school has a Hwb account. Hwb provides a secure learning platform for pupils to use a range of ICT tools and to communicate safely. Hwb includes Microsoft Office 365 tools, including email, Word, Excel and PowerPoint. We use Hwb to work on the curriculum in school and pupils can also access their learning at home. Hwb is funded by Welsh Government and is available free to all schools in Wales.
